Retired Navy nurse Captain Susanne Blankenbaker spoke of her service during Burlington's annual Veterans Days ceremony.

Friday, Nov. 11, Burlington Schools held a Veterans Day program for the community. The band and choir had been practicing for a few weeks.

The band accompanied the students singing the "Star Spangled Banner" and played "God Bless America." The elementary students also provided musical entertainment. A favorite tradition is the "Armed Forces Medley" during which veterans of the various branches stand during the singing of their official fight song.

The seniors all had speaking parts throughout the program. Guest speaker Captain (retired) Susanne Blankenbaker, offered her thanks to the school for such a thoughtful program and spoke to the crowd about her career as a military nurse. She was commissioned in 1997 into the Navy Nurse Corps and retired in September of 2021. She completed several deployments and received numerous medals during her time in service.

After the program, the teachers provided a meal for all the veterans and their families.
